Crankshaft bearings – replacement
346XP, 351, 353

If the crankshaft bearings are to be replaced, tap
them out gently using drift 502 70 84-01.

The new bearings must be shrunk-fit into the
crankcase using a hot air gun.

Sealing ring – replacement

Remove the sealing ring from the magnet side
using tool 502 50 55-01.

Sealing ring replacement - drive side

Remove the oil pump.

1

Pry up the sealing ring from the bearing by using a
small screwdriver or the like.
Note. The sealing ring can be replaced without the
need of removing the bearing.

2
Press the new sealing ring into the bearing.

Crankshaft complete - dismantling
340, 345, 350

1
Remove the following:

• chain and bar

• clutch cover

• cylinder cover

• starter assembly*

• ignition system*

• generator

• centrifugal clutch*

• throttle pushrod

• carburettor*

• silencer*

• piston and cylinder*

• fuel tank*

* See special instructions.

2

Lift the crankshaft completely out of the crankcase.

350:
Unbolt the four bolts from underneath and lift off
the spacer.
Lift the crankshaft completely out of the crankcase.
